Samuel Johnson's Dictionary
Rednessnoun
The quality of being red.
Etymology: from red.
There was a pretty redness in his lips. William Shakespeare.
In the red sea, most apprehend a material redness, from whence they derive its common denomination. Brown.
The glowing redness of the berries vies with the verdure of their leaves. Spectator, №. 477.
ChatGPT
redness
Redness is a condition or quality in which an object, surface or skin appears reddish or pinkish in color. It can be a result of inflammation, high blood pressure, temperature, light reflections or presence of certain pigments. In the context of human body, it often indicates increased blood flow or an immune response. It is also used to describe the hue resembling that of blood, fire, or rubies.
